  • Vintomas wrote: 87 points

    September 14, 2016 - Georges Descombes with Caviste (Grappe, Stockholm): Nose with red berries and some cherries, some animal and developed notes, slightly flowery. The palate is medium-bodied and berry-dominated with cherries, good acidity, well embedded tannins, and an aftertaste which first is berry-dominated and then finishes a bit more firm and apply. 87 p.

    This wine is distinctly different from the 2014 Brouilly VV.

    Last year I scored this wine lower and commented “So young that it is a bit difficult to evaluate next to the other wines” (which were of the 2013 vintage).
